Nestled in the heart of Colorado County, Weimar, Texas, offers a unique blend of small-town charm and modern conveniences, making it an ideal place for those seeking a peaceful yet connected lifestyle. This welcoming community, with its picturesque streets and friendly atmosphere, ensures that residents feel right at home. Weimar is celebrated for its rich heritage and cultural vibrancy, showcased in annual events such as the Weimar Gedenke! Festival, which celebrates local German and Czech heritage with music, food, and crafts. The town also boasts exceptional local amenities including well-equipped parks, such as the Weimar City Park, which features sports facilities, walking trails, and picnic areas ideal for family outings. For educational needs, Weimar offers highly rated public schools that emphasize both academic excellence and sports, creating a well-rounded environment for children to thrive. Health and wellness services are readily available with multiple healthcare centers nearby. Additionally, the strategic location midway between San Antonio and Houston provides residents with easy access to major city amenities, including international airports, shopping centers, and specialized medical services. The local economy is bolstered by a mix of agricultural and small business enterprises, providing ample employment opportunities while maintaining a low cost of living.
